This week we’re taking a look at the hairstyles of each character in our web series du jour: An African City. Today we’re checking out  Ngozi (who’s played by actress Esosa E) and her braids.

Per the AAC website, “Ngozi, a Nigerian and the youngest of the five ladies, was raised in Maryland. After earning her graduate degree in international affairs, she was offered a job at a development agency in Accra. Much to the dismay of her friends, Ngozi is the religious one of the group.”

For the first three episodes Ngozi consistently rocks her braids in a funky, yet neat up do but varies her look with makeup, adding gentle splashes of color that seem to match her ditzy yet sweet personality. It isn’t until the fourth episode do we see Ngozi let her hair down, literally and play with darker edgier eye shadows.
